China has produced an estimated 500 J-20 ‘Mighty Dragon’ stealth fighter jets, cementing the aircraft’s position as the backbone of the People’s Liberation Army Air Force (PLAAF), says defence analyst Andreas Rupprecht, cited in a report by The War Zone. 

The development comes as India continues work on its indigenous Advanced Medium Combat Aircraft (AMCA), which is expected to take around a decade to enter operational service. While Russia’s Su-57 may not offer the same level of stealth capability, it could emerge as India’s only immediate option should an urgent need arise.
